Went to my Big Lots today they were just starting to set up the tiki and Hawaiian stuff.

They didn't have much out but I looked at the shelf set-up guide they had and it looks like it's going to be mostly dishware. Lots of glasses and plates.

Of the cooler stuff they had were 4 different color large tiki mugs. Those were $3.99 each and a large tiki drink pitcher for $3.99. The pitchers came in green and brown AND...they were wearing colorful sunglasses and flowers behind their ears...uhhh handle.

I believe they are going to have a smaller version of the three stacked tikis (ala the Disney tikis). The sheet I looked at showed them on a lower shelf with maybe 36 inches of head room.

This here be one of the 4 colored Tiki Mugs at Big Lots. There was also blue, red and (I think) yellow. They stand about 8 inches tall and 4 inches across at the top.

The pitcher is about 9 1/2 inches tall.

The tiki thing sticking out of the mug is a wooden yard pick. At least I think that's what they called it. They are all wooden and stand pretty tall. In a case there are about 3 designs. One is a hula girl and I can't remember what the other one was. As far as I could tell it was a new case they had open and I only saw one tiki in the whole case.
